Manual Reset Safety Shutoff Over-Temperature Thermostat
Top Dryer Used For This Example
This thermostat is manually reset by pushing in the red button. The Over Temperature Thermostat is a
safety backup for the entire Heat Circuit and located in the recirculation chamber area on the side of the
burner housing. If the dryer over heats this Over Temperature Thermostat it opens the line to turn off the
heat but leaves the Computer Board lighted and the drive motor powered and turning so the basket will
cool down.
Cool Down
Top Dryer Used For This Example
At the preprogrammed time (2 minutes factory setting--adjustable) the Computer Board will open the Gas
Relay Contact. This allows the Drive Motor to continue to run but without heat. The gas light on the com-
puter board should not be illuminated anytime the computer is in cool down. This Cool Down period allows
the clothing (zippers, snaps, etc.) time to cool down to a temperature that is easily handled by customers.
End of Cycle
Top Dryer Used For This Example
At the end of the cool down, the Computer Board opens the Upper Run Relay, which removes power from
the Motor Control Relay (R1) and also removes power to the Drive Motor. The motor light on the computer
board should no longer be illuminated. The Drive Motor and tumbler stops and the Computer Board dis-
play now flashes until the dryer loading door is opened. Once the dryer loading door is opened to remove
the clothing the display goes back to vend price.
